Alcibiades was one of the most dazzling figures of Athens' Golden Age. A friend of Socrates, he was spectacularly rich, bewitchingly handsome and charismatic, a skilled general, and a ruthless politician. He was also a serial traitor. David Stuttard tells a spellbinding story of Alcibiades' life and the turbulent world he set out to conquer.
